    Go buy KILZ Primer.

    Prime walls twice, then paint.

    I removed all those ugly connecting trim strips and filled in the gaps with dap paintable caulk, smoothed it with my fingers, then I primed and painted. My walls look like tongue and groove now. Very updated!! Good luck.

    You can buy a wallpaper that is designed to cover the grooves. It will give a smooth wall even when applied over cinder block walls. The paper can have a a nice texture to it and then when painted it will look like a nice wall and not just painted paneling. BE SURE TO APPLY SIZING TO THE WALL BEFORE ADDING WALLPAPER. That way it can be removed years later - if desired.
